The Security Advisors specializes in school security. They work primarily with career colleges (trade schools, for profits). One of our popular training program is "Dealing with Disruptive and Aggressive Behavior in the School and Classroom". They have just started marketing a new Compliance Package for colleges for Sexual Violence Education. PA law requires that all institutions of higher education and private colleges provide a Sexual Violence Education program for all matriculating students. The Compliance Package includes a new Sexual Violence Awareness video that we shot on location on Cortiva Institute of Massage Therapy in King of Prussian and the Four Seasons Catering Hall in Norristown. It covers everything that the PA law requires. The producer was Fleetwalker Productions. The PA Association of Private School Administrators (PAPSA) asked us to come up with something for their members. They are thinking about doing a similar video aimed at High School Students. They are also looking for a location to shoot a basic school awareness video for K through 12. Schools will get this video for free for their administrators and faculty to view.
